"No man is an island" and "For whom the bell tolls" are just two of the phrases from John Donne's poetry which are known to virtually everyone. John Donne (1572-1631) is considered the best of the metaphysical poets and one of the greatest writers of love poetry ever. This volume is a fully comprehensive annotated edition of Donne's poetry and a landmark volume in literature publishing.


  • Extensive editorial commentary for each poem
  • Headnotes set poems in historical context
  • Text has been modernised in punctuation and spelling except where to do so would alter or disrupt a rhyme

Publication Date: August 1, 1998| ISBN-10: 0820410195 | ISBN-13: 978-0820410197"The Journalism, Volume I: 1834-1846, the definitive authoritative, MLA scholarly edition, is a volume in « The Collected Writings of Walt Whitman, the Whitman « Writings that « every library should own ("Choice). Volume I reprints 589 Whitman editorials, articles, essays, other prose matter, and poems from 20 journals, including 5 newspapers that Whitman edited. These writings were hitherto unreprinted or uncollected, or only available in out-of-print limited collections, most with unreliable t...
